The National Instruments NI-9212 is a premium module categorized under the C Series Analog Input modules. It is specifically designed to cater to a wide range of applications including in-vehicle data logging, battery stack testing, and white goods testing. This module features 8 isolated thermocouple channels, making it an ideal choice for sophisticated measurement tasks.
When it comes to measurement accuracy, the NI-9212 offers two versions with distinct accuracies: one version (part number 785259-01) provides an accuracy of 0.71 degrees C, while the other version (part number 782975-01) offers a superior accuracy of 0.39 degrees C. This ensures precise measurements for critical applications.
Channel-to-channel isolation is another significant specification of the NI-9212. The module with part number 785259-01 offers an isolation of 60 Vrms, whereas the version with part number 782975-01 provides a higher isolation level of 250 Vrms. This feature is crucial for safety and accuracy in measurements involving high voltage levels.
The NI-9212 is equipped with two types of front connectors: the Mini-TC connector for part number 785259-01 and the Screw Terminal for part number 782975-01. This flexibility allows for easy and secure connections depending on the specific requirements of the application.
Compatibility with CompactDAQ and CompactRIO platforms is a key feature of the NI-9212, ensuring seamless integration into existing setups. This module is also compatible with LabVIEW software, offering a comprehensive environment for developing measurement and control systems.
The module boasts a maximum sample rate of 95 S/s per channel, enabling fast data acquisition for dynamic testing scenarios. Additionally, the NI-9212 supports hot-swapping, allowing users to replace modules without shutting down the entire system, thereby minimizing downtime.
The maximum voltage range of ±78.125 mV, combined with an analog to digital converter resolution of 24 bit, ensures high fidelity measurements. The module also features open thermocouple detection, which is vital for identifying disconnected thermocouples, ensuring the reliability of the measurement data.
